为了配合突破长压选股公式再上突破长压主图,源码如下:
参数:
n 最小;1.00 最大:30.00 缺省:8.00
n1 最小;1.00 最大:300.00 缺省:5.00
n2 最小;1.00 最大:300.00 缺省:10.00
n3 最小;1.00 最大:300.00 缺省:20.00
n4 最小;1.00 最大:300.00 缺省:60.00
n5 最小;1.00 最大:300.00 缺省:120.00
n6 最小;1.00 最大:300.00 缺省:250.00
DRAWBAND(MA(CLOSE,N4),RGB(250,80,120),MA(CLOSE,N5),RGB(30,80,10));
DRAWBAND(MA(CLOSE,N1),RGB(200,80,120),MA(CLOSE,N2),RGB(80,130,100));
DRAWKLINE(HIGH,OPEN,LOW,CLOSE);
{涨跌幅度}
{以下涨停红柱、跌停绿柱、涨幅>5%洋红柱、跌幅达>5%蓝柱}
C9:=REF(C,1);
V1:=IF(NAMELIKE('ST') OR NAMELIKE('*ST'), 5, 10);
非ST涨停:=IF((C-C9)*100/C9>=(10-0.01*100/C9),1,0);
涨停:=非ST涨停;
STICKLINE(涨停,OPEN,CLOSE,3,0),COLOR000099;
STICKLINE(涨停,OPEN,CLOSE,1.86,0),COLOR0000CC;
STICKLINE(涨停,OPEN,CLOSE,0.5,0),COLOR0000FF;
STICKLINE(涨停,H,L,0,0),COLOR6633FF;
{}
非ST跌停:=IF((C9-C)*100/C9>=(10-0.01*100/C9),1,0);
跌停:=非ST跌停;
STICKLINE(跌停,HIGH,LOW,0,0),COLOR66FF00;
STICKLINE(跌停,CLOSE,OPEN,3.2,0),COLOR33CC00;
STICKLINE(跌停,CLOSE,OPEN,3,0),COLOR009900;
STICKLINE(跌停,CLOSE,OPEN,1.8,0),COLOR00CC33;
STICKLINE(跌停,CLOSE,OPEN,0.5,0),COLOR00FF00;
半涨1:=IF((C-C9)*100/C9>=(5-0.01*100/C9),1,0);
半涨2:=IF((C-C9)*100/C9<(10-0.01*100/C9),1,0);
JRS:=半涨1 AND 半涨2 AND FINANCE(33)>0;
STICKLINE(JRS,OPEN,CLOSE,3,0),COLORCC0099;
STICKLINE(JRS,OPEN,CLOSE,1.86,0),COLORCC00CC;
STICKLINE(JRS,OPEN,CLOSE,0.5,0),COLORFF00FF;
STICKLINE(JRS,H,L,0,0),COLORFF66FF;
{跌幅达>5%蓝柱}
{半跌1:=IF((C9-C)*100/C9>=(5-0.01*100/C9),1,0);
半跌2:=IF((C9-C)*100/C9<(10-0.01*100/C9),1,0);
JES:=半跌1 AND 半跌2 AND FINANCE(33)>0;
STICKLINE(JES,HIGH,LOW,0,0),COLORFF9933;
STICKLINE(JES,CLOSE,OPEN,3.2,0),COLORFF9933;
STICKLINE(JES,CLOSE,OPEN,3,0),COLORFF6633;
STICKLINE(JES,CLOSE,OPEN,1.8,0),COLORFF9933;
STICKLINE(JES,CLOSE,OPEN,0.5,0),COLORFFCC33;}
{显示涨跌幅}
NUMBER:=COUNT(非ST涨停,BARSSINCE(非ST涨停)+1);
DRAWNUMBER(非ST涨停,HIGH*1.02,NUMBER),COLORYELLOW;
DRAWNUMBER_FIX(CURRBARSCOUNT=1,0.95,0.98,0,NUMBER),COLORYELLOW;
DRAWTEXT_FIX(CURRBARSCOUNT=1,0.85,0.98,0,'上市以来共涨停:'),COLORRED;
{}
MMA1:MA(CLOSE,N1),COLORWHITE;
MMA2:MA(CLOSE,N2),COLORYELLOW;
MMA3:MA(CLOSE,N3),COLORMAGENTA,LINETHICK2;
MMA4:MA(CLOSE,N4),COLORGREEN,LINETHICK2;
MMA5:MA(CLOSE,N5),COLORLIBLUE;
MMA6:MA(CLOSE,N6),COLORBLUE,LINETHICK2;
{}
{突破显示23号图标白圈红十角}
均价:=(2*C+(H-L)/2+L+O)/4;
价差:=SUM(均价-REF(均价,1),3)/3;
实价:=(均价+价差);
MA8:=MA(实价,8);
MA24:=MA(实价,24);
MM:=EMA(均价+价差,53),COLORCYAN;
XM:=EMA(均价,53);
I0:=(EMA(MM,3)+EMA(MM,6)+EMA(MM,12)+EMA(MM,24))/4;
I1:=(EMA(XM,3)+EMA(XM,6)+EMA(XM,12)+EMA(XM,24))/4;
牛熊线:=0.5*(I0+I1),LINETHICK,COLORRED;
多头:=COUNT(MA24>牛熊线,10)=10;
ZD:=MAX(MA8,MAX(MA24,牛熊线));
ZX:=MIN(MA8,MIN(MA24,牛熊线));
粘合:=ABS(ZD/ZX-1)*100<=15;
TP:=MIN(牛熊线*1.15,MA24*1.13);
DRAWICON(FILTER(CROSS(C,TP) AND 粘合 AND 牛熊线>REF(牛熊线,1),18) ,L+0.1,23);{突破显示23号图标};
AA2:=REF(C,9)=LLV(C,2*9+1); B2:=FILTER(AA2,9); C2:=BACKSET(B2,9+1);
AA3:=REF(C,10)=HHV(C,2*10+1); B3:=FILTER(AA3,10); C3:=BACKSET(B3,10+1); HD1:=FILTER(C3,10);
AA4:=REF(C,60)=HHV(C,2*60+1); B4:=FILTER(AA4,60); C4:=BACKSET(B4,60+1); HD2:=FILTER(C4,60);
近压:=REF(C,BARSLAST(HD1));
长压:=REF(C,BARSLAST(HD2));
STICKLINE(C,近压,近压,3,2),COLORYELLOW,LINETHICK1;
STICKLINE(C,长压,长压,3,2),COLORWHITE,LINETHICK1; |